Opportunity Description
The Internet Archive provides National Emergency Library that is a book collection supporting emergency remote teaching, research activities, intellectual stimulation, and independent scholarship, training centers, schools, and libraries are closed. This library offers Free services for interested book readers from anywhere in the world to study their favorite books choosing from 1.4 million books.
Internet Archive get the books by partnering with Better World Books, public domain books
Details:
Number of books: 1428380
Study mode: online
Time valid for each book to borrow and study: Two weeks (14 days)
This library is free up to June 30 or the end of the emergency situation in the world.
Books are offered in various subjects. you may able to find any book you want to read
How to use the books offered at National Emergency Library?
Applicants can sign up for an internet archive account for free, then browse the books or search your favorite book and borrow them for fourteen days to read.
